Rights and Responsibilities
Landlord-tenant law balances property owners' need to operate rental housing with tenants' right to safe, habitable homes.
Typical legal topics include:
- Lease drafting, renewals, and rent increases
- Security deposits, habitability, and repair obligations
- Handling tenant defaults, lease violations, and evictions
- Fair housing compliance and anti-retaliation laws
Recurring Disputes
- Maintenance and habitability complaints
- Unauthorized occupants or pet disputes
- Rent withholding or collection actions
- Conflicts over lease renewals and notices

When to Hire Counsel
Engage a lawyer when communications break down or deadlines are tight.
- You received or need to serve legal notices
- Repairs, rent, or behavior issues remain unresolved
- You are accused of discrimination or retaliation
- You operate multiple units and need policies that comply with local law

Fees at a Glance
Expect flat-fee consults for lease reviews and hourly rates for ongoing representation.
- Retainers for repeat or portfolio landlords
- Flat fees for notice drafting or uncontested matters
- Court filing and service costs for eviction proceedings
